Distribution
Ceanothus ferrisiae is endemic to Santa Clara County, California, where it is known from only four or five occurrences near Mt. Hamilton in the Diablo Range. The largest population, located near Anderson Dam, is recovering from a 1992 wildfire that killed 95% of the plants. It is a member of the serpentine soils endemic flora and it occurs in chaparral. It is a federally listed endangered species.
